Double Glazing Window Installers Near Me
It's essential to select an experienced window manufacturer when you're considering double glazing window installation glazing. This will ensure the quality of the work and materials. It's also a good idea to get multiple estimates and compare prices.
Double glazing is comprised of two glass panes separated by an insulation gas, such as argon. It is more efficient than single glazing and helps reduce the cost of energy.
Getting quotes
double glazed window installers glazing is an excellent option if you want to enhance the appearance of your home and improve the efficiency of your energy. But, it is essential to choose a reputable installer for the job since windows can be costly and you want the best value for your budget. You can determine the reputation of a company by looking up online testimonials and reviews. You can also seek recommendations from trusted tradespeople.
A reliable window company will offer transparent pricing and finance options for your project. They should also offer warranties on products and installation services. Compare quotes from different contractors before making your decision. Include all costs, including materials, labor and other services, in your estimate.
Check that the contractor is FENSA registered and abides by the building regulations. This will help you save time and ensure that the job is done properly. FENSA is a non-profit organization that monitors double glazing installations.
When requesting estimates, it is important to remember that different manufacturers offer windows with varying prices. Some brands offer special pricing on standard sizes. In these instances you can ask for an explanation of the price in order to determine the actual cost.
You should also find out whether the company provides free consultation and survey to assess your requirements and give you a thorough estimate. This will help you avoid any hidden costs and surprises later on. Additionally, you should inquire about the process of installation and the preparations required prior to windows being installed. The last thing to do is ensure that the installer provides you a realistic completion date.
Reputation
When you are looking for a double glazed windows installation glazing window installer, it's crucial to choose one that has a good track record. Asking around or reading reviews online is one method of doing this. You may also want to inquire with local tradespeople, such as plumbers or builders, for suggestions. Most of the time, these professionals be working with local double-glazing businesses and are more than happy to share their knowledge with you.
Double glazing is a great method to improve the comfort of your home, particularly in winter. It is also more secure, as the two panes are separated by a sturdy framework. They are also more efficient in energy than single glazing. They are constructed of insulated panels that help to keep heat inside your home and prevent it from escaping. They are available in different styles and finishes that will fit the aesthetics of your home.
The British Fenestration Rating Council assigns energy-efficiency ratings for double-glazed windows. These ratings are based on the amount of thermal insulating material and the type of gas used to fill the gap between glass panes and the quality of the manufacturing. The more high the rating of double-glazed windows, the more insulation it is.
Certain double-glazing manufacturers offer several financing options. Crystal Windows and Doors, for instance offers a monthly installment option and a buy-now option, which can be paid later. It also provides 10 years of guarantee and a 20-year guarantee against fogging and condensation. Another company worth considering is Britelite Windows. This window manufacturer is operating for more than 50 years, focuses on energy efficiency and security. The company offers a variety of uPVC products and is backed by a BSI Kitemark.
